Preparation Checklist for Customers

Freshly cleaned windows improving light in a Bayswater home

Preparing for a window cleaning appointment is usually straightforward, but a little planning helps the visit go more smoothly and can improve the final result. If you are arranging window cleaning in Bayswater for a home, office, or commercial property, the following checklist may be useful.

Before the appointment, consider:

  • Unlocking side gates or shared entry points if access is needed
  • Moving fragile items away from windows, especially indoors
  • Clearing window ledges of ornaments, plants, or paperwork
  • Letting the cleaner know about difficult windows, security screens, or alarms
  • Parking arrangements if access to the front of the property is limited
  • Identifying any windows that should not be opened or handled in a certain way

For commercial properties, it can also help to advise staff in advance so they know when the clean is taking place. This is particularly useful for reception areas, clinics, offices, and customer-facing premises where timing matters. The more clearly the job is planned, the more smoothly it tends to run.

Residents in apartment buildings may also need to consider building access, concierge procedures, lift use, and shared common areas. In those cases, local experience is valuable because it helps avoid delays and awkward surprises.

Pricing Factors to Understand

Customers often want to know what affects the cost of window cleaning without being given vague answers. The truth is that pricing usually depends on the details of the property and the work required. It is reasonable to expect a clear conversation about the factors that influence the quote, even if exact prices are not listed upfront.

Common pricing factors include:

  • Number of windows and glass panels
  • Whether the clean is inside, outside, or both
  • Height of the property and access difficulty
  • Condition of the glass and how long it has been since the last clean
  • Whether frames, sills, and extras are included
  • Parking or access limitations that may affect the visit
  • Frequency of service, such as one-off versus regular maintenance

This is why an accurate quote usually depends on a quick understanding of the property rather than a generic estimate. Homes with a few easily reached windows are very different from multi-level commercial buildings or apartments with restricted access. A fair quote should reflect the real work involved, not just a rough guess.

Common Questions from Bayswater Customers

People usually want clear answers before they book. Below are some of the questions that come up most often when arranging local window cleaning. These are the practical concerns that matter in real life, especially when you are balancing access, timing, and different types of property.

How often should windows be cleaned?

That depends on the property, its surroundings, and how quickly dirt builds up. Busy streets, trees, construction dust, and weather exposure can all make a difference. Some customers book regular cleans every few weeks or months, while others arrange a one-off service when the glass starts to look dull.

Can you clean hard-to-reach windows?

Many hard-to-reach windows can be cleaned with the right equipment and planning, but access always needs to be assessed properly. Upper-storey windows, rear-facing panes, and awkward extensions may require extra care. It is best to mention difficult areas when asking for a quote so the job can be approached safely and efficiently.

Do I need to be home?

That depends on whether interior windows are included and what access arrangements are needed. For exterior-only work, some customers do not need to be present if the access points and instructions are clear. If the job includes internal glass, someone usually needs to be available to provide access and make sure any belongings near the windows are moved out of the way.

Will frames and sills be included?

That depends on the service requested. Some customers only want the glass cleaned, while others prefer a more complete finish that includes frames and sills. If that matters to you, it is worth asking at the quoting stage so expectations are clear before the work begins.

Can you help with shopfronts and business premises?

Yes, many window cleaning services in Bayswater work with local businesses. Shopfront glass, office windows, and entrance doors often need regular maintenance to keep a professional appearance. Business customers often prefer flexible scheduling so the work can happen before opening hours, after trade, or at another quiet time.
